🛝Toolio
Todas las herramientas Acerca de Contacto

📡 Referencia de Códigos de Estado HTTP

Los códigos de estado HTTP son números de tres dígitos que el servidor devuelve con cada respuesta para indicar al cliente qué ocurrió. Hay 5 clases: 1xx (informativo), 2xx (éxito), 3xx (redirección), 4xx (error del cliente) y 5xx (error del servidor). Usa el buscador o los filtros de categoría para encontrar cualquier código al instante.

Acerca de

Esta herramienta incluye los 62 códigos de estado HTTP estándar definidos en RFC 7231, RFC 4918 (WebDAV), RFC 6585, RFC 7538, RFC 8470 y estándares relacionados, sin necesidad de conexión a internet. Cada código muestra su valor numérico, nombre oficial, descripción clara y su insignia de clase. Haz clic en cualquier tarjeta para copiar el número de código al portapapeles.

Cómo usar

  1. Escribe un número (p. ej., 404) o una palabra clave (p. ej., «redirect») en el buscador para filtrar códigos al instante.
  2. Usa los filtros de categoría (Todos / 1xx / 2xx / 3xx / 4xx / 5xx) para ver solo la clase que necesitas.
  3. Haz clic en cualquier tarjeta para copiar el número de código al portapapeles — una notificación confirma la copia.
  4. Combina la búsqueda y los filtros de categoría — funcionan juntos para que puedas, por ejemplo, buscar «auth» solo dentro de la clase 4xx.
  5. Usa el teclado: Tab hasta una tarjeta, luego presiona Enter o Espacio para copiar — completamente accesible sin ratón.

Preguntas frecuentes

¿Qué significa el código HTTP 404?
404 Not Found significa que el servidor no puede localizar el recurso solicitado. La URL puede estar mal escrita, la página puede haber sido eliminada o el recurso puede haberse movido sin una redirección. Es el error HTTP más frecuente que encuentran los usuarios web.
¿Cuál es la diferencia entre redirecciones 301 y 302?
301 Moved Permanently indica que el recurso se ha movido permanentemente a una nueva URL, por lo que los navegadores y motores de búsqueda actualizan sus registros. 302 Found indica un movimiento temporal: los navegadores siguen la redirección pero continúan usando la URL original para futuras solicitudes. En SEO, los 301 transfieren el link equity a la nueva URL; los 302, no.
¿Qué causa un error 500 Internal Server Error?
Un error 500 significa que el servidor encontró una condición inesperada: es un comodín para fallos del lado del servidor. Las causas comunes incluyen excepciones no controladas en el código de la aplicación, configuraciones incorrectas del servidor, condiciones de falta de memoria, fallos de conexión a la base de datos o errores de sintaxis en scripts del servidor. Revisa los registros de errores del servidor para diagnosticar la causa raíz.
¿Cuál es la diferencia entre 401 Unauthorized y 403 Forbidden?
401 significa que la autenticación falta o es inválida: el servidor no sabe quién eres. Enviar credenciales válidas puede solucionarlo. 403 significa que el servidor sabe quién eres pero se niega a autorizar la acción — las credenciales no ayudarán porque el acceso simplemente no está permitido para tu cuenta o rol.
¿Los códigos de estado HTTP son los mismos en HTTP/2 y HTTP/3?
Sí. HTTP/2 y HTTP/3 cambiaron la capa de transporte (encuadre binario, multiplexación, QUIC) pero mantuvieron la misma semántica de códigos de estado que HTTP/1.1. Un 200, 404 o 500 significa exactamente lo mismo independientemente de la versión del protocolo. Los códigos listados aquí se aplican a todas las versiones de HTTP en uso activo.